Hello,

I try to create invoice from the timesheet of employee. Each hour is considered as a unit. I want to convert hour (8) in Days (1). Is it possible to parameter it ?

I'm not sure if this answers your question, however I'm also using the timesheet modules and create invoices from the hours entered by employees.

By default, we enter working time in number of hours. So each day we enter 8 hours. However when we print timesheets, working times are shown in days. This behaviour can be changed in the Unit of Measurements form by making hours the default UOM for UOM-category Working Times.

It is possible to change it in the Settings (> Project Management > Working time unit). However, it will not change any values when you change this setting. It should however use the 2.00 days vs 2:00 hours. It will take it into account when you invoice your timesheets.
